Transaction ed1763e59b64500b80d2051c41ea70e641e3ce554b3049c74d663853b29a7265
1 Input
1 Output
-
ed1763e59b64500b80d2051c41ea70e641e3ce554b3049c74d663853b29a7265:0
- value
- 607181
- script pubkey
- OP_0 OP_PUSHBYTES_20 868ec2fdb33cb665fe0eb8207db1ee9d3117571c
- address
- bc1qs68v9ldn8jmxtlswhqs8mv0wn5c3w4cu46zfx6